For many, the game day experience starts long before kickoff, with the sacred ritual of tailgating. The smell of charcoal grills, the sounds of laughter and music, the friendly competition for the best setup – it’s a spectacle in itself.
Tailgating with your own food is a classic option, allowing you to showcase your grilling skills and create a personalized feast. If you plan to go this route, be sure to familiarize yourself with FedEx Field’s tailgating policies. There are guidelines regarding permitted areas, alcohol consumption, and disposal of waste. Sticking to these rules will ensure a smooth and enjoyable tailgating experience for everyone.
But maybe you’d rather leave the cooking to someone else and focus on soaking in the pre-game atmosphere. In that case, catering is your secret weapon. Numerous local businesses specialize in creating game-day menus, bringing the party right to your tailgate. From succulent barbecue ribs and juicy burgers to mouthwatering sides and refreshing drinks, they’ll handle all the culinary details while you mingle with fellow fans. Look for catering options offering packages designed specifically for tailgating, considering portability, ease of serving, and cleanup. Maximize Your Experience: Game Day Tips and Tricks
Navigating the dining scene near FedEx Field on game day can be a challenge, but with a little planning, you can ensure a smooth and enjoyable experience.
Making reservations is strongly recommended, especially for sit-down restaurants. Game days are notoriously busy, and waiting times can be long. Securing a reservation will guarantee you a table and minimize your wait time.
Consider the traffic and parking challenges. Game-day traffic can be heavy, and parking spaces can be scarce. Utilize ride-sharing services, public transportation, or designated parking areas to avoid parking hassles.
Verify restaurant hours before heading out. Some restaurants may have adjusted schedules on game days. Checking their hours in advance will prevent any unwanted surprises.
Utilizing mobile ordering apps can save time. Many restaurants offer mobile ordering options, allowing you to place your order in advance and skip the line.
Check online reviews for up-to-date information. Online reviews provide valuable insights from other diners, helping you make informed decisions about where to eat.
